WitrynaOntario's immigration programs include the Ontario Immigrant Nominee Program and Ontario Express Entry. In 2024, Ontario can nominate up to 6,600 nominees through these two programs. What is the Canadian Experience Class (CEC)? This class is for foreign student graduates and foreign workers with skilled work experience in Canada. WitrynaThe National Occupational Classification (NOC) is Canada’s national system for describing occupations. You can search the NOC to find where an occupation is classified or to learn about its main duties, educational requirements or other useful information.
